President Karzai Orders the Governors
and Provincial Security Chiefs to Stop Poppy Cultivation
Office of the Presidential Spokesman
10/31/2005
Arg, Kabul - H.E. Hamid Karzai, President
of the Islamic Republic of Afghanistan, ordered the governors
and provincial security chiefs to take drastic actions against
poppy cultivation in Afghanistan.
The President said, “Our country’s
national interests require us to refrain from poppy cultivation.
The fight against poppy cultivation is a top priority for the
Government of Afghanistan and no excuse will be accepted for
the continuation of poppy cultivation. Afghanistan will not
become self-reliant unless we completely stop this menace with
strong determination.”
In a meeting with governors and provincial security
chiefs, the President instructed them to inform the land owners
of the Government’s strong determination in fighting against
illicit poppy cultivation. The cultivation of poppy is an illegal
act which undermines the rule of law and weakens our economy.
